Improved Integration Efficiency and Potential for Further Enhancements in Monitoring and User Experience
The policies in MuleSoft API Manager are significant features. We get the policies by default, with more than 25 out-of-the-box policies. If any additional requirement exists specific to the customer, there is a custom policy framework. We can build the policy according to our requirement, and deploy and enable it at the API Manager level to consume across different business groups, environments, or organizations altogether within the platform. Developing the custom policy is not challenging; you just need to follow the custom policy framework to implement. The custom policy and the different levels of SLAs of the API Manager are notable. Regarding the monitoring side of the API Manager, MuleSoft provides substantial monitoring with logs, offering search capability, raw data accessibility, and different subscriptions. With the top tier, integration with third-party platforms such as ELK or Splunk becomes unnecessary because all search capabilities, dashboards, and functional monitoring can be built within the platform itself. This is excellent from the monitoring perspective, and there have been recent improvements focusing on observability. For DevOps, if you want to make your continuous integration and continuous deployment effective, irrespective of the tool, there are options to integrate. For example, you can use the Maven plugin, platform APIs, or CLI to build your end-to-end DevOps cycle.

A tool that ensures that its users see a return on investment from its use
The UI and the fact that the product is not easy to use are areas with shortcomings where improvements are required. Documentation isn't available for everything in the solution, so you may have to figure out a lot of things by yourself. Pipedream is easy to use for someone with tech skills or someone new who is trying to learn how to code. Though it is user-friendly for people with tech skills, it is not at all user-friendly for people who do not have any tech skills. The user interface of Pipedream is very simple compared to the user interfaces of some other products like monday.com or Asana. Asana and monday.com have visually appealing user interfaces. The user interface of Pipedream is not visually appealing at all. The aforementioned details need to be considered for improvement in the solution. I just wish there was a little bit more documentation on how everything worked when it came to deployment since I was a fairly new employee at the company at that time. Sometimes, the workflow wouldn't work fine in Pipedream, and I had to check it myself for errors. Finding the errors in Pipedream is hard to find. I think it would be good if Pipedream had the ability to send an email to notify you that there is an error with the code instead of having to go back in and then look every day or every hour if there was an error in the code.
